Average Ticket Price on a 1-Day, 1-Park in 2025:
However, note that Universal's parks typically have shorter normal operating hours. In 2024, Universal's parks would average about 10.9 hours a day, while WDW parks were open nearly an additional hour at 11.8 hours. Based on 2024 hours, Universal's parks would cost about $13.64 per hour (avg. 1-Day park admission at $149), while Disney would be
slightly cheaper at $13.57 per hour (avg. $160 1-day park admission).
Average Quick Service Entree Price & Google Review/Rating of UOR/WDW/SW Parks:
SeaWorld Orlando has the highest price with Universal Studios Florida being 2nd (Minion Cafe & Leaky Cauldron are pricey options).
- Magic Kingdom $12.75 | 3.9 (surprisingly cheapest QSR, though arguably the worst offerings)
- Epcot $13.20 | 4.0
- Disney's Hollywood Studios $12.88 | 4.0
- Disney's Animal Kingdom $14.00 | 4.2
- Universal Studios Florida $16.25 | 3.6
- Universal Islands of Adventure $13.58 | 3.6
- SeaWorld Orlando $19.58 | 3.4
- Disneyland $15.03 | 4.0
- Disney California Adventure $14.17 | 4.1
- Universal Studios Hollywood $13.18 | 3.3
Average Table Service Entree Price & Google Review/Rating at UOR/WDW parks:
Clearly, Disney is out of their minds when it comes to in-park table service options.
- Magic Kingdom $48.33 | 4.1
- Epcot $61.53 | 4.3
- Disney's Hollywood Studios $38.23 | 4.2
- Disney's Animal Kingdom $44.85 | 4.4
- Universal Studios Florida $26.75 | 4.2
- Universal Islands of Adventure $25.51 | 4.1
While we can go back and forth on who offers the better value, UOR is just behind WDW in ridiculous pricing.
